Indian National Congress held the seat; the winning margin widened from 10.0% to 51.6%.

Boundaries were redrawn between 1962 and 1967 — the comparison is matched by name and is indicative only.

  • New challengerBharatiya Jana Sangh (BJS) finished second with 16.7% — it did not contest here in 1962.
  • Safe seatIndian National Congress won by more than 25 points — a stronghold, not a contest.
  • Multi-cornered3 candidates cleared 5% — a genuinely multi-cornered fight.
